数据库单位叫什么
-
数据库单位通常被称为数据库管理系统(Database Management System,简称DBMS)。DBMS是一种软件,用于管理和组织存储在数据库中的数据。它提供了一种访问和操作数据库的方式,使用户能够有效地存储、查询、更新和删除数据。
在DBMS中,数据以表的形式组织,每个表包含多个行和列。每一行表示一条记录,每一列表示一个数据字段。通过使用SQL(Structured Query Language,结构化查询语言),用户可以向DBMS发送查询和操作指令,以实现对数据库的管理和操作。
DBMS可以分为多种类型,包括关系型数据库管理系统(RDBMS)、面向对象数据库管理系统(OODBMS)、层次型数据库管理系统(HDBMS)等。每种类型的DBMS都有其特定的优点和适用场景。
总之,数据库单位通常被称为数据库管理系统(DBMS),它是一种软件,用于管理和组织存储在数据库中的数据,提供了一种访问和操作数据库的方式。
1年前 -
数据库单位通常被称为“表(Table)”。在数据库中,表是数据的集合,它由行和列组成。每一行代表一个数据记录,而每一列代表一个数据字段。
下面是关于数据库单位的更详细解释:
-
表(Table):表是数据库中最基本的单位,用于存储数据。每个表都有一个唯一的名称,并且由多个列组成。表中的行表示数据记录,而列表示数据字段。
-
行(Row):行也被称为记录,是表中的每个数据项。每一行代表一个实例或一个具体的数据记录。例如,在一个学生表中,每一行可能代表一个学生的信息,包括学生的姓名、年龄、性别等。
-
列(Column):列是表中的每个数据字段。它定义了表中每个数据项的类型和属性。例如,在一个学生表中,每个列可能代表学生的姓名、年龄、性别等。列也被称为字段(Field)或属性(Attribute)。
-
主键(Primary Key):主键是表中的一列或一组列,用于唯一标识表中的每个数据记录。主键的值必须是唯一的,并且不能为空。主键可以帮助在表中快速查找和更新数据。
-
外键(Foreign Key):外键是表中的一列或一组列,用于与其他表建立关联。外键可以将两个表之间的数据关联起来,并确保数据的完整性。通过外键,可以在一个表中引用另一个表中的数据。
总结:数据库单位通常被称为“表”,它由行和列组成。行代表数据记录,列代表数据字段。表中的每个数据记录都有一个唯一的主键,用于标识数据记录。外键用于建立表与表之间的关联。
1年前 -
-
数据库单位通常被称为数据库管理系统(Database Management System,简称DBMS)。数据库管理系统是一种软件,用于管理和操作数据库中的数据。它允许用户定义、创建、查询、更新和删除数据库中的数据。数据库管理系统还提供了数据安全性、完整性和一致性的保证,以及数据备份和恢复的功能。
数据库管理系统可以分为关系型数据库管理系统(Relational Database Management System,简称RDBMS)和非关系型数据库管理系统(NoSQL Database Management System,简称NoSQL DBMS)两种类型。
关系型数据库管理系统使用表格来组织和存储数据。数据以行和列的形式存储在表格中,并且通过定义关系(主键、外键等)来建立表格之间的联系。常见的关系型数据库管理系统包括Oracle、MySQL、Microsoft SQL Server和PostgreSQL等。
非关系型数据库管理系统采用不同的数据模型来存储数据,如文档型、键值型、列族型和图形型等。非关系型数据库管理系统主要用于处理大规模的非结构化数据,如社交媒体数据、日志文件等。常见的非关系型数据库管理系统包括MongoDB、Cassandra、Redis和Neo4j等。
无论是关系型数据库管理系统还是非关系型数据库管理系统,它们都提供了一系列的操作和管理数据库的方法和技术。下面将介绍一些常见的数据库操作流程和技术。
-
数据库设计和建模:
- 根据实际需求,确定数据库的结构和关系模型。
- 根据实体和关系,设计数据库的表格和字段。
- 使用数据库设计工具,如ER图工具,进行数据库建模。
-
数据库创建和初始化:
- 使用数据库管理系统提供的命令或图形界面工具,创建数据库。
- 创建数据库表格和字段,并定义字段的数据类型和约束。
- 初始化数据库,插入初始数据。
-
数据库查询和检索:
- 使用SQL语言(结构化查询语言)编写查询语句,查询数据库中的数据。
- 使用数据库管理系统提供的图形界面工具,执行查询并查看结果。
- 使用索引和优化技术,提高查询性能。
-
数据库更新和修改:
- 使用SQL语言编写更新语句,更新数据库中的数据。
- 使用数据库管理系统提供的图形界面工具,执行更新操作。
- 使用事务管理技术,保证数据的一致性和完整性。
-
数据库备份和恢复:
- 定期进行数据库备份,以防止数据丢失。
- 使用数据库管理系统提供的备份和恢复工具,执行备份和恢复操作。
- 使用冗余和故障转移技术,提高数据库的可用性和可靠性。
-
数据库安全和权限管理:
- 设置数据库访问权限,限制用户对数据库的操作。
- 使用加密技术,保护数据库中的敏感数据。
- 定期进行安全审计,检查数据库的安全性。
以上是数据库管理系统的一般操作流程和技术。不同的数据库管理系统可能有一些特定的操作和技术,但总体来说,数据库管理系统的目标是提供高效、可靠和安全的数据管理和操作能力。
1年前 -